Output 90043c1899a540c775e3987e62b9acc716666ea66ff5d86739a0cc02765ce19f:21

value
105541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ff843844ac7b5cb5573a56cca28ec359de52ae OP_EQUAL
address
3NUZQgjDaAJjQmSnS21sJZyFCynraBWj3h
transaction
90043c1899a540c775e3987e62b9acc716666ea66ff5d86739a0cc02765ce19f
spent
true